SlideShare a Scribd company logo
Brandon
West
SendGrid
Manager, Developer Relations

@bwest

Who am I ?

brandon@sendgrid.com
SendGrid
Documentation
& Open Source Projects
Why Documentation Matters
ProgrammableWeb.com API Survey Results

Copyright © KOZO KEIKAKU ENGINEERING Inc. All Rights
Reserved
What Documentation Does

Developers Self Serve
Reduce Support Tickets

Establishes Credibility

Copyright © KOZO KEIKAKU ENGINEERING Inc. All Rights
Reserved
API Workshop
Test the API
from browser.
No code.

!
New version
coming soon!

Copyright © KOZO KEIKAKU ENGINEERING Inc. All Rights
Reserved
Documentation Is Not Easy
• We are on our third version of documentation. The first 2 were bad.	

• It’s a big job. We’re now hiring a person to manage it full time.	

• Things are constantly changing

Copyright © KOZO KEIKAKU ENGINEERING Inc. All Rights
Reserved
What Makes Sustainable Documentation?
• Change tracking / version control	

• Ease of deploying changes	

• Maintainability of platform	

• Smart constraints	

• Smart defaults	

• Ease of editing content	

• Defined structure	

• These are a lot of the same things that make code sustainable.

!

Copyright © KOZO KEIKAKU ENGINEERING Inc. All Rights
Reserved
!8
Open Source Libraries

PHP

C#

Node.js

Obj-C

Perl

Go

Python

Java
https://github.com/sendgrid/
Copyright © KOZO KEIKAKU ENGINEERING Inc. All Rights
Reserved
Most Popular Libraries

PHP
C#

Based on views on Github
over the last 2 weeks

Python
Node.js

Copyright © KOZO KEIKAKU ENGINEERING Inc. All Rights
Reserved
Why Have Open Source Libraries?
• Reduce the amount of work it takes for new users to get started	

• Developers like package managers such as npm, nuget, rubygems	

• Provides example implementations even if devs don’t use them	

• Lets us provide smart defaults — e.g. Web API instead of SMTP	

• If we don’t build them, someone will. But we get the questions!	

• It’s fun 😊
Copyright © KOZO KEIKAKU ENGINEERING Inc. All Rights
Reserved
Not Just API Wrappers

• Our documentation is open source! github.com/sendgrid/docs	

• New newsletter subscription widget is also open source	

• We’re trying to open source more projects as well

Copyright © KOZO KEIKAKU ENGINEERING Inc. All Rights
Reserved
Thank you !!

More Related Content

PPTX
Mvpskill Saturday EP_11 10 August 2562 - Azure Products Update + DEMO
PDF
Open APIs: What's Hot, What's Not?
PDF
Hackathons + developer evangelism +you
PPTX
SendGridサンプルの紹介
PDF
あなたはどのSendGrid?
PDF
SendGrid Night - Japan
PDF
SendGrid New Features 2016
PPTX
SendGrid Night in Fukuoka #1
Mvpskill Saturday EP_11 10 August 2562 - Azure Products Update + DEMO
Open APIs: What's Hot, What's Not?
Hackathons + developer evangelism +you
SendGridサンプルの紹介
あなたはどのSendGrid?
SendGrid Night - Japan
SendGrid New Features 2016
SendGrid Night in Fukuoka #1

Viewers also liked (8)

PPTX
Web制作的SendGridのススメ SendGridで色々やってみた話
PDF
Sending Emails Reliably & Quickly from Your Cloud Foundry App with SendGrid ...
PPTX
Twilio x SendGrid x Bluemix実践ハンズオン
PDF
How To IM Like a Business Pro
PDF
How To Write Business Email That Delivers Results
PDF
Email Strategy, Design and User Experience
PDF
[WMD 2015] Interstate Analytics >> Jamie Quint, "Measuring for Revenue Attrib...
PDF
[WMD 2015] SendGrid >> Pedro Sorrentino, "Email Strategy For Starters: When, ...
Web制作的SendGridのススメ SendGridで色々やってみた話
Sending Emails Reliably & Quickly from Your Cloud Foundry App with SendGrid ...
Twilio x SendGrid x Bluemix実践ハンズオン
How To IM Like a Business Pro
How To Write Business Email That Delivers Results
Email Strategy, Design and User Experience
[WMD 2015] Interstate Analytics >> Jamie Quint, "Measuring for Revenue Attrib...
[WMD 2015] SendGrid >> Pedro Sorrentino, "Email Strategy For Starters: When, ...
Ad

Similar to SendGrid documentation & open source projects (20)

PDF
QCon'17 talk: CI/CD at scale - lessons from LinkedIn and Mockito
PDF
CI/CD: Lessons from LinkedIn and Mockito
PDF
Juc boston2014.pptx
PPTX
Github for Serious Business Professional
PDF
Communication tool & Environment for Remote Worker
PPTX
Modern Web-site Development Pipeline
PDF
Vibe Coding_ Develop a web application using AI (1).pdf
PPTX
GitHub_Copilot_Presentation_For_Bachlor_Student_level
PDF
SGCE 2015 REST APIs
PDF
APIs distribuidos con alta escalabilidad
PDF
Language Matters: JavaScript 
from IoT Product Concept 
to Production
PDF
From Heroku to Amazon AWS
PPTX
Cyto Node JS talk
PPT
Case study
PPTX
Introduction to Python Programming Basics
PDF
Android development at mercari 2015
PDF
Approaching APIs
PDF
API Design Workflows
PDF
Continuous Delivery at Snyk
PPTX
JS digest. Decemebr 2017
QCon'17 talk: CI/CD at scale - lessons from LinkedIn and Mockito
CI/CD: Lessons from LinkedIn and Mockito
Juc boston2014.pptx
Github for Serious Business Professional
Communication tool & Environment for Remote Worker
Modern Web-site Development Pipeline
Vibe Coding_ Develop a web application using AI (1).pdf
GitHub_Copilot_Presentation_For_Bachlor_Student_level
SGCE 2015 REST APIs
APIs distribuidos con alta escalabilidad
Language Matters: JavaScript 
from IoT Product Concept 
to Production
From Heroku to Amazon AWS
Cyto Node JS talk
Case study
Introduction to Python Programming Basics
Android development at mercari 2015
Approaching APIs
API Design Workflows
Continuous Delivery at Snyk
JS digest. Decemebr 2017
Ad

More from SendGrid JP (6)

PDF
Email Deliverability Guide - メールを確実に届けるために
PDF
Google Cloud Platformスタートアップハンズオン SendGrid + Google App Engine
PDF
IPウォームアップとは?【SendGrid】
PDF
【SendGrid】もっとメールを活用するためのAPIガイド
PDF
【SendGrid】マーケティングメール&トランザクションメール 〜もっと成果をあげるには?〜
PDF
【SendGrid入門】クラウドでメールを活用するメリット
Email Deliverability Guide - メールを確実に届けるために
Google Cloud Platformスタートアップハンズオン SendGrid + Google App Engine
IPウォームアップとは?【SendGrid】
【SendGrid】もっとメールを活用するためのAPIガイド
【SendGrid】マーケティングメール&トランザクションメール 〜もっと成果をあげるには?〜
【SendGrid入門】クラウドでメールを活用するメリット

Recently uploaded (20)

PDF
Modernizing your data center with Dell and AMD
PDF
How UI/UX Design Impacts User Retention in Mobile Apps.pdf
PDF
Machine learning based COVID-19 study performance prediction
PDF
Build a system with the filesystem maintained by OSTree @ COSCUP 2025
PDF
Shreyas Phanse Resume: Experienced Backend Engineer | Java • Spring Boot • Ka...
PPTX
KOM of Painting work and Equipment Insulation REV00 update 25-dec.pptx
PPT
“AI and Expert System Decision Support & Business Intelligence Systems”
PDF
Approach and Philosophy of On baking technology
PDF
Agricultural_Statistics_at_a_Glance_2022_0.pdf
PPTX
PA Analog/Digital System: The Backbone of Modern Surveillance and Communication
PPTX
Digital-Transformation-Roadmap-for-Companies.pptx
PDF
Bridging biosciences and deep learning for revolutionary discoveries: a compr...
PDF
Unlocking AI with Model Context Protocol (MCP)
PDF
TokAI - TikTok AI Agent : The First AI Application That Analyzes 10,000+ Vira...
PDF
Review of recent advances in non-invasive hemoglobin estimation
PDF
Building Integrated photovoltaic BIPV_UPV.pdf
PDF
Diabetes mellitus diagnosis method based random forest with bat algorithm
PPTX
A Presentation on Artificial Intelligence
PDF
Peak of Data & AI Encore- AI for Metadata and Smarter Workflows
PDF
Chapter 3 Spatial Domain Image Processing.pdf
Modernizing your data center with Dell and AMD
How UI/UX Design Impacts User Retention in Mobile Apps.pdf
Machine learning based COVID-19 study performance prediction
Build a system with the filesystem maintained by OSTree @ COSCUP 2025
Shreyas Phanse Resume: Experienced Backend Engineer | Java • Spring Boot • Ka...
KOM of Painting work and Equipment Insulation REV00 update 25-dec.pptx
“AI and Expert System Decision Support & Business Intelligence Systems”
Approach and Philosophy of On baking technology
Agricultural_Statistics_at_a_Glance_2022_0.pdf
PA Analog/Digital System: The Backbone of Modern Surveillance and Communication
Digital-Transformation-Roadmap-for-Companies.pptx
Bridging biosciences and deep learning for revolutionary discoveries: a compr...
Unlocking AI with Model Context Protocol (MCP)
TokAI - TikTok AI Agent : The First AI Application That Analyzes 10,000+ Vira...
Review of recent advances in non-invasive hemoglobin estimation
Building Integrated photovoltaic BIPV_UPV.pdf
Diabetes mellitus diagnosis method based random forest with bat algorithm
A Presentation on Artificial Intelligence
Peak of Data & AI Encore- AI for Metadata and Smarter Workflows
Chapter 3 Spatial Domain Image Processing.pdf

SendGrid documentation & open source projects

  • 3. Why Documentation Matters ProgrammableWeb.com API Survey Results Copyright © KOZO KEIKAKU ENGINEERING Inc. All Rights Reserved
  • 4. What Documentation Does Developers Self Serve Reduce Support Tickets Establishes Credibility Copyright © KOZO KEIKAKU ENGINEERING Inc. All Rights Reserved
  • 5. API Workshop Test the API from browser. No code. ! New version coming soon! Copyright © KOZO KEIKAKU ENGINEERING Inc. All Rights Reserved
  • 6. Documentation Is Not Easy • We are on our third version of documentation. The first 2 were bad. • It’s a big job. We’re now hiring a person to manage it full time. • Things are constantly changing Copyright © KOZO KEIKAKU ENGINEERING Inc. All Rights Reserved
  • 7. What Makes Sustainable Documentation? • Change tracking / version control • Ease of deploying changes • Maintainability of platform • Smart constraints • Smart defaults • Ease of editing content • Defined structure • These are a lot of the same things that make code sustainable. ! Copyright © KOZO KEIKAKU ENGINEERING Inc. All Rights Reserved
  • 8. !8
  • 10. Most Popular Libraries PHP C# Based on views on Github over the last 2 weeks Python Node.js Copyright © KOZO KEIKAKU ENGINEERING Inc. All Rights Reserved
  • 11. Why Have Open Source Libraries? • Reduce the amount of work it takes for new users to get started • Developers like package managers such as npm, nuget, rubygems • Provides example implementations even if devs don’t use them • Lets us provide smart defaults — e.g. Web API instead of SMTP • If we don’t build them, someone will. But we get the questions! • It’s fun 😊 Copyright © KOZO KEIKAKU ENGINEERING Inc. All Rights Reserved
  • 12. Not Just API Wrappers • Our documentation is open source! github.com/sendgrid/docs • New newsletter subscription widget is also open source • We’re trying to open source more projects as well Copyright © KOZO KEIKAKU ENGINEERING Inc. All Rights Reserved